## Overview

The Buffalo LS441DE-EU LinkStation 441 is a 4-bay desktop NAS enclosure designed for small businesses and home offices, offering up to 16TB of customizable storage with RAID support. Powered by a 1.2GHz Marvell Armada CPU and 512MB DDR3 RAM, it ensures high-performance data handling. It includes 5 licenses of NovaBACKUP Professional for robust data protection and supports seamless remote access via free apps. With private cloud capabilities, multi-device HD streaming, and compatibility with Mac Time Machine backups, it combines security, flexibility, and convenience in one sleek package.

Product Description All Your Data Accessible and SecureBuffalo Technology’s new LinkStation 441D series is a complete network storage solution for small business and home office with potentially huge capacity and great flexibility. Buffalo’s new NAS is a 4 bay customisable storage solution that comes with Buffalo’s free and private personal cloud keeping your data both accessible and secure. Buffalo Technology’s LS441D series is available as a diskless enclosure or fully populated with 4, 8, 12, or 16TB capacity. Securely store, share, and save all your dataThe LS441D is ready for intensive data storage tasks and when fully populated, users can choose from multiple levels of RAID support for customised capacity and redundancy according to their specific needs. And no matter where you go, all your data is accessible from any web browser or with Buffalo’s free apps for Android, iOS, and Windows Phone. And with Buffalo’s Private Cloud solution users’ data stays protected in the physical location of the device – not off-site in a third party’s data centre. Back at home, Buffalo’s new LinkStation is DLNA compatible, and Twonky Beam ready, and can stream multiple HD films simultaneously allowing each family member to watch their favourite film, on their own device, at the same time. The LS441 can also stream high-end DSD audio files without losing quality. **Q: Do all the disks have to be the same capacity?**
A: Yes they do as the device creates a raid array across all 4 disks and each drive must be the Same size to do this. However if the drive is bigger then it will still work but you will only be able to use the space on the bigger drive that is the same size as the others.

I have read the US Amazon reviews (et al) but many are (as usual) misleading, so I thought I'd just try buying one. It works pretty well, but the performance is poor, but fine for the money. Expect ~20-24MB/s writes and ~50MB/s reads to the box on 1Gb/s ethernet. Some boring & random technical guesswork: The Armada 370 is a "System On a Chip", and the ARM7 core (1.2GHz) is plenty fast enough and I reckon it has enough memory tacked on the mainboard - the issue with performance (if you look at the architecture) is that the SoC is based around a small number of high speed buses feeding a switch. I reckon this is where the bottle is. http://www.marvell.com/embedded-processors/armada-300/assets/ARMADA370-datasheet.pdf By way of a check, each of my drives, on large reads and writes when used in my USB-3 dock runs at 90-120 MB/s depending on the position in the disk. My ethernet port is Gbit, and with the right sink, I can max it out. My test setup used 4x 2TB 7200 HGST drives in RAID 5. The disks are SATA-III but the unit only works at SATA-II rates (the documentation is misleading), but with 4 drives essentially working in concert this makes little difference to performance given the other bottlenecks. Writing large files to the RAID box over ethernet/SMB, I get 20-24 MB/s. Reading large files I get ~50MB/s. Not too bad, but nothing compared with a USB-3 dock. Small file transfers can be as low as 2MB/s. The big file data rates are what I expect, given that to use the XOR engines (used to calculate parity) it'll require at least 3 times as much data shuffling across the switch fabric in and out of memory.... Anyway... Initial RAID build took 20 hours or so (I was in bed when it finished). This is worth doing because every usable sector on every disk is read and written and any bad sectors will get remapped by the disks. I ended up with about 5.5 TB of usable data, and it will take several days to fill this up. My ethernet was running at 250mbit/s during writes, so this is nowhere close to its max. I was originally not using jumbo frames, which seems to make a positive difference if you turn it on, but the ethernet comms is only one quarter or half of its max rate, and I suspect the processing overhead on the ARM7 core is not a big issue compared with the the relatively low speeds in and out of the switch fabric. I will retry over WiFi and with jumbo frames on ethernet at some point. As for the initial "error mode" problem, see my comment to the other reviewer. It's no big deal. A major flaw is not supporting NTFS as a file system on USB-connected drives. Now pretty common; not everything is FAT32. Not having iSCSI is an omission, given it's just a software stack, but I can live without it. All-in-all I recommend it for a convenient RAID box on your home LAN, for day-to-day use. I for one will keep separate disks with my important stuff, because a RAID box is a single point of failure in its own right, and if the unit dies, you'll be unlikely to get any data off the disks. I would also assume that from checking Buffalo support on the 'net, you'll get no support for a serious problem beyond the the UK gold standard of "turn it off and on again". Additional info: Turning on 9K jumbo frames (on PC and on LS441) boosted write speeds to 30-32 MB/s for large files. Not stunning but worth it if you have several days of writes to get through. Don't forget this won't work on WiFi or if you have a basic switch that doesn't support jumbo frames.
